In the last post about my vocal synthesis project, I talked about implementing the Wide-Band Voice Pulse Modeling algorithm. Since then, I've actually done some original research of my own and have devised what I believe to be three minor improvements to the algorithm.
I implemented the Wide-Band Voice Pulse Modeling algorithm (from Dr. Jordi Bonada's PhD thesis: https://www.tdx.cat/bitstream/handle/10803/7555/tjbs.pdf)"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://www.tdx.cat/bitstream/handle/10803/7555/tjbs.pdf) via the upsampling method (specifically, upsampling via a natural cubic spline). There are actually two methods proposed in that paper, the other being via periodization. There is actually a patent that pertains to WBVPM, but it only covers the periodization version (which is what they used for their results), so I have implemented the upsampling method instead. I have been able to validate the main results in that paper; specifically, its shape-invariance and lower residual when compared to other methods. Furthermore, I have devised three significant improvements to the algorithm - two of which are only possible because I used the spline approach, so in a sense it was good that I had to do it that way. Of the three improvements, I have implemented the first two and shown their advantage of the original WBVPM algorithm. The resulting score has been obtained by taking the mean of the relative of residual level (i.e. the difference between the original and reconstructed signal; relative to the level original signal). I have done so on an audio sample that deliberately exhibits traits that were noted as negatively affecting the WBVPM algorithm's resulting quality. Notably, a low pitch voice with rapid and deep vibrato, transients, strong amplitude modulation, and a large portion of the sampling being between a voiced/unvoiced/voiced transition. First I should note that my WBVPM implementation is currently far from optimal. The pitch estimation system (via the modified TWM algorithm) has not undergone testing and tuning of its parameters, and there are many variations of the TWM algorithm to consider. Additionally, I have not implemented unvoiced/voiced detection (because, as far as I can tell, it is not mentioned in Bonada's thesis; presumably it's in prior literature, but I have not researched it yet), so all the algorithms act as if they are always processing a voiced signal even when they are not. RESILIENT BORDER INTERPOLATION IN SYNTHESIS - When I first implemented the synthesis step for WBVPM, it was late at night and I was tired. I wanted a quick result before I went to bed and didn't understand the wording of the description of the synthesis step in WBVPM. As such, my original implementation differed significantly. Instead of using the overlap-and-add, it instead, for each sample, found the closest voice pulse and determined its value for that time, taking advantage of the spline that was generated for downsampling and using the periodic nature of the pulse to extend it when the sample was beyond its domain (i.e. the opposite of overlapping). This approach lead to high-frequency crackling artifacts due to discontinuities between the voice pulse boundaries. The following day, I properly understood the synthesis approach and rewrote the synthesis code. Interestingly, this actually gave worse overall results. While the high frequency artifacts were gone, there were now large low frequency artifacts that appeared as large modulations in the time-domain. I eventually tracked this down to being a bug in my implementation of the MFPA algorithm that sometimes resulted in massive errors of up to 1.5 radians. I fixed this bug and the reconstruction synthesis no longer had significant artifacts, but I thought it was interesting that my approach, despite having the discontinuity issue, was more resilient to errors in the MFPA estimation. I began thinking if the two approaches could be combined to create an even better approach. I was thinking about why the modulation occurred in the case of the overlap-and-add method. Thinking about it, when the fundamental frequency is stationary and the MFPA onsets are perfect, the trapezoidal window function is equivalent to a weighted average between two adjacent voice pulses over the duration of twice the border interpolation size. However, when the MFPA onsets are inaccurate, or even just when the fundamental frequency is non-stationary, this is no longer true. Even worse, thinking about it from the weighted average point of view, the sum isn't necessarily one everywhere anymore, hence the modulation. I then devised a method that would not result in modulation. This method works by first synthesizing the 'inner' portion of each pulse (by 'inner', I mean starting at the end of the border interpolation at the start, and ending before the start of the next border interpolation towards the end of the pulse). Then, for the gaps in between each pulse, we calculate each sample value by a weighted average of two values. These are values are the values of each voice pulse at that time. Since the gap extends beyond the boundaries of each voice pulse, we use the periodic nature of the pulses to compute the effective position in the voice pulse by taking the position modulo the period of the fundamental frequency at that voice pulse. The fundamental frequencies of each of the voice pulses may differ, so we actually change step in time linearly. At each end of the gap, the step size for the voice pulse it is next to is one sample in time, while the step for the former voice pulse is the equivalent of one sample in the latter voice pulse relative to the former's fundamental frequency (e.g. if the second voice pulse has twice the fundamental frequency as the first; the step size for the first would be 2 and tep size for the second would be 1, at the end of the gap). For the start of the gap, it is the same except relative to the first pulse having a step of 1. In between, we the step size interpolate linearly. It is worth noting that in the ideal case where the onsets are exactly correct and the fundamental frequency is stationary, the result of this approach is the same as using the trapezoidal window. FREQUENCY WARP-CORRECTION - As noted in Bonada's thesis, WBVPM assumes that the fundamental frequency is stationary within each pulse, however this is not actually true, and that the artifacts from this are particularly apparent for low fundamental frequency voice signals, because each period of the signal is longer in time and thus the internal state of the system has more time to change. One of the changes that can happen over time is modulation of the fundamental frequency. This can be thought of actually as a time-domain remapping function that distorts each voice pulse according to a continuous fundamental frequency trajectory. I discovered a way of correcting this, largely by accident as I was thinking about solving the modulation issue I discussed in the previous section. I was thinking about how I proposed changing the step size linearly in the gaps between the 'inner' pulses. I was thinking, we have a discrete sequence of fundamental frequencies. So, what if instead of changing the step size linearly, we instead created a spline from the fundamental frequencies and instead changed the step size based on that? Then I realized that we could also use this for the whole voice pulses and just sample everything with a step size based on the fundamental frequency trajectory. I then realized that this would actually act like the distortion from changing parameters within each voice pulse, at least in the synthesis stage. Further more, since we are already computing splines for each voice pulse to downsample it, this comes at very little additional computational cost. However, the voice pulses in analysis are already distorted. So then I already we can do the inverse resampling in the upsampling stage of WBVPM analysis to correct for non-stationary frequency, then it is redistorted according to the transformed fundamental frequency trajectory in the synthesis stage. This makes this method effectively invariant to modulations in fundamental frequency, so long as the modulation is less than the fundamental frequency and it is modeled well by the spline, which should be the case for modulation period is at least several voice pulses. PITCHED/UNPITCHED DECOMPOSITION - As mentioned in Bonada's thesis, WBVPM only models sinusoids, and thus residual in the input signal is encoded as flucuations between the spectra of voice pulses. I devised a post-processing technique to separate the voice pulses into sinusoidal and residual components. I have not actually implemented and test this yet, because as it is post-processing step, it will not improve the residual level, and in fact, will probably make it worse. The benefit of it is in the transformation stage, which is much harder to quantify and which I have not finished implementing. However, I believe this approach should work. (continued in next post) |

Cars that only exist because of import restrictions thread
This is the Hindustan Ambassador, at one point being 70% of all cars driven in India. It was manufactured from 1957 to 2014. Reportedly there was never an improvement year by year and to purchase the vehicle you had to wait on a list for 6 months to 2 years until the Indian economy liberalized in 1991. |

🇹🇷 The tomb of Pir Esad Sultan (known as"Kitten Sheikh"), a 13th-century Seljuk Sheikh in Konya, Türkiye, famous for his love of cats. The smaller tomb beside his is for his beloved cat.

Hello, I'm back and I have a major update to my VOCALOID project! I have sucessfully achieved a shape-invariant pitch transposition!
Here it is. First the original audio: https://files.catbox.moe/zmt3rr.wav"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/zmt3rr.wav Now my version with WBVPM (pitched down by an octave): https://files.catbox.moe/kho97n.wav"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/kho97n.wav And a version using a naive pitch shift: https://files.catbox.moe/xs39bq.wav"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/xs39bq.wav Notice that my version, while having more noise, sounds more natural and has less phasiness. This is particular noticeable if you play both at very low volume. One sounds much more 'human' than the other. Also note that this an extreme example with an octave shift (or 1200 cents) - in practice, shifts would typically be far less. Also this doesn't implement several other parts of the system (more on that later). I'll explain all of this in a moment, but first, I'd to correct some major biographical errors. Since this is a long post, I've divided it into sections BIOGRAPHICAL CORRECTIONS In the last post, I claimed that VOCALOID1 used Narrow-Band Voice Pulse Modeling while VOCALOID2 and onwards used Wide-Band Voice Pulse Modeling. This was incorrect, and additionally it was the source of most of my confusion surround the paper. What actually happened is that the research technology that would later become VOCALOID1 started out as work to improve the existing Spectral Modeling Synthesis system that had been developed in the early 1990s. This improvement began work in the late 1990s. But importantly, this system evolved and techniques from it were incorporated with techniques from a system that was being developed called a Phase-Locked Vocoder, and this system would be released as VOCALOID1. In the mid-2000s, work began on combining the techniques learned from improving SMS and the PLVC-based system and attempting to combine them with the mucher older and well-known TD-PSOLA system. Importantly, TD-PSOLA (Time-Domain Pitch Synchronous OverLap and Add) was a time-domain system, while SMS was a frequency-domain system (and also TD-PSOLA was pitch synchronous - hence the name, while SMS had a constant hop size). The first technique they developed was Narrow-Band Voice Pulse Modeling, and later Wide-Band Voice Pulse Modeling. Wide-Band Voice Pulse Modeling ended it up being used in VOCALOID2. Now that I understand this, I also understand the major mistake I made when reading the paper: I was reading it from the perspective of an implementer, thinking of the sections as the steps to implementing it instead of as research. I had thought that section 2.2 described the core processing algorithms. When it was actually about SMS, and importantly, about *the improvements they made to SMS*, and not a complete description of SMS, since SMS was already an established technique. Hence my confusion on why some things were seemingly vaguely explained, since *the paper wasn't about them*. At the same time, much of that section is very useful though because importantly, much of that research was also incorporated into the later techniques. RESULTS I have successfully implemented the Wide-Band Voice Pulse Modeling; synthesis; and pitch transposition, time stretching, and timbre scaling algorithms. Additionally, I have also finished implementing the full version of the pitch estimation module, changed the code to work using overlapping windows, implemented the window adaption system, and fixed countless. Importantly, I have been able to experimentally replicate a very important property - and one of the main reasons WBVPM was developed, in fact. That property is shape-invariance. You see, an important property of the human voice is that, all else being equal, the shape of each pulse in the waveform stays roughly the same regardless of frequency. The reason for this property is phase-coherence. At the start of each voice pulse (when the glottis closes), the phases of all the harmonics within each formant (where each 'formant' is a spectral region affected by the vocal tract differently) are roughly the same. Since phase changes proportionally to frequency, the different harmonics will shift from that point over time, and soon become very different from one another. Since the phases are vastly different with relation to the frequency at times other than the voice pulse onset, the harmonics interfere constructively and destructively in the time-domain. Importantly however, if all the harmonics are scaled equally, the phases all now change at a slower or faster rate, but importantly this rate scales the same for all of them. This gives rise to shape-invariance, since the pattern of interference stays the same, just at different scales. Importantly, if you apply a transform relative to a point that is not a voice pulse onset, the phases will not be flat. Of course, that transform can shift the changes *from* the point it started from, but importantly it is NOT accounting for inherent phase shift that occurs from not being at a voice pulse onset. Of course, if no transform is occurred, then there will be no issue. But if one is, say a pitch transposition, then the initial phases from the starts if signal was actually shifted to the pitch originally will differ considerably from the observed ones since the observed ones base themselves on the measured phase *at a different pitch*. This results in the breaking of shape-invariance, a noticeable 'phasiness' sound, and the sound sounding un-human. Here is an image of 500 samples from the original signal: https://files.catbox.moe/223l7p.png"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/223l7p.png Now here is 1000 from a one octave down pitch transposition using a naive approach (a fixed-window and hop-size approach using a 1024-point Hann window): https://files.catbox.moe/jxgtg0.png"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/jxgtg0.png Notice that not only is the waveform unrecognizable compared to the original, it even varies considerably between individual voice pulses! Now compare to 1000 samples from the WBVPM approach: https://files.catbox.moe/6hpf8l.png"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/6hpf8l.png Notice how the waveform is almost identical, only scaled up two times in period, and it varies much less. You may be wondering, couldn't we just downsample or upsample the signal and play it back at the same sample rate to get the same result? Well, importantly, we have independent control over pitch and time. In the example, I downsampled the voice by a factor two, but kept the time the same and it contains the same number of samples as the original. Additionally, in the analysis and then synthesis reconstruction, it is seperating it into individual voice pulses. Importantly, it isn't just scaling them, it is generating new voice pulses in the frequency domain and inserting them at positions that were also generated. Here is an amplitude envelope of the latter half of the original audio: https://files.catbox.moe/6zw5v5.png"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/6zw5v5.png Now here is an amplitude envelope of the latter half of the pitch-transposed audio: https://files.catbox.moe/2a3utu.png"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/2a3utu.png Notice how they a roughly the same. If the audio was just downsampled, the second would be stretched out by a factor of two - but is not. I also implemented timbre-scaling, although I have not tested it. Fun fact; when I implemented it, actually did so by accident. I was trying to implement the pitch transposition, got a bit confused, and realized I had also accidently implemented timbre scaling. All these transforms are currently implemented as linear transformers. However, they are all implemented by just sampling a spline at a regular interval, so they could be trivially made to accept a non-linear parameter, sequence of points, or spline instead. Although this current implementation is far from perfect, I think it works reasonably well as a demonstration of the techniques and their properties. Keep in my mind that I have done nearly no adjustment of the constant parameters/'tuning'. In fact, there are several parameters whose corresponding feature is effectively disabled because I wasn't sure what value to pick. This implementation could probably be considerably improved just by adjusting a few constant. An (hopefully) efficient and accurate way of 'tuning' automatically is discussed later in this post. Notably, the pitch-transposed spectrum varies significantly, with some areas showing little residual and straight lines: https://files.catbox.moe/04naz0.png"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/04naz0.png (those lines in some areas around the center of the spectrum are probably the aliasing artifacts Bonada 2008 mentioned in WBVPM when using upscaling, I will implement the method for avoiding them at some point) Additionally, I have also tested reconstructing the sound with no transforms. This seems yield little residual, although it seems concentrated at higher frequencies, so maybe that can be fixed. Maybe it could also be caused by aliasing. Here is an audio file that was reconstructed through the WBVPM synthesis procedure using downsampling: https://files.catbox.moe/bhxjpw.wav"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/bhxjpw.wav And a spectrogram: https://files.catbox.moe/kvrnkq.png"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/kvrnkq.png Compare to the spectrogram of the original: https://files.catbox.moe/d1vo16.png" rel="nofollow noreferrer" target="_blank">https://files.catbox.moe/d1vo16.png PITCH ESTIMATION Throughout this project, the most finicky part has been - and continues to be - the pitch estimation; specifically the Two-Way Mismatch algorithm for monophonic pitch detection. I have compiled several variations of the TWM algorithm. I tested one change that worked by scaling a term by the amplitude (I had actually though of this idea myself, and this term happened to be the term I mentioned causing me trouble last time), and it led to considerable improvement so I kept it. |
